Oakland recorded 120 homicides in 2022 a homicide rate of more than 27 per 100,000 residents, by far the highest of the 15 cities that provided data to The Chronicle. Between 2018 and 2022, the average time it took police to arrive after 911 received a call about a high-priority incident ballooned from 12.7 minutes to 19.1 minutes, more than a 50% increase.
